CAUTION
During night or IMC conditions, apply the procedure immediately. Do not delay reaction for diagnosis.
During daylight VMC conditions, with terrain and obstacles clearly in sight, the alert may be considered cautionary. Take positive corrective action until the alert ceases or a safe trajectory is ensured.
* "PULL UP" — "TERRAIN TERRAIN PULL UP" — "TERRAIN AHEAD PULL UP"
Simultaneously :
— AP OFF
— PITCH PULL UP
Pull up to full back stick and maintain.
— THRUST LEVERS TOGA
— SPEED BRAKES LEVER CHECK RETRACTED
— BANK WINGS LEVEL or adjust
For "TERRAIN AHEAD PULL UP" only, in addition to climbing, and if the crew concludes that turning is the safest way of action, a turning maneuver can be initiated.
* When flight path is safe and GPWS warning ceases : Decrease pitch attitude and accelerate.
* When speed is above VLS and vertical speed is positive : Clean up aircraft as required.
* "TERRAIN TERRAIN" — "TOO LOW TERRAIN" :
Adjust the flight path or initiate a go-around.
* "TERRAIN AHEAD" :
Adjust the flight path. Stop descent. Climb and/or turn, as necessary, based on analysis of all available instruments and information.
* "SINK RATE" "DON'T SINK" :
Adjust pitch attitude and thrust to silence the alert.
* "TOO LOW GEAR" — "TOO LOW FLAPS" : Correct the configuration or perform a go-around.
* "GLIDE SLOPE" :
Establish the airplane on the glideslope, or switch OFF the G/S mode pushbutton, if flight below the glideslope is intentional (non precision approach).

Traffic advisory : "TRAFFIC" messages
— Do not maneuver based on a TA alone. — Attempt to see the reported traffic.
— Preventive resolution advisory : "MONITOR VERTICAL SPEED"
message
— Maintain or adjust the vertical speed, as required, to avoid the red area of the vertical speed scale.
— Attempt to see the reported traffic. — Notify ATC.
— When "CLEAR OF CONFLICT" is announced :
Resume normal navigation in accordance with ATC clearance.
R Corrective resolution advisory : All "CLIMB" and "DESCEND"
or "MAINTAIN VERTICAL SPEED MAINTAIN" or "ADJUST
VERTICAL SPEED ADJUST" type messages.
— Respond promptly and smoothly to an RA.
— AP (if engaged) OFF
— BOTH FDs OFF
— Adjust the vertical speed, as required, to that indicated on the green area of the vertical speed scale.
NOTE : Avoid excessive maneuvers while aiming to keep the vertical speed just outside
the red area of the VSI, and within the green area. If necessary, use the full speed range between Vamax and Vmax.
— Respect stall, GPWS, or windshear warning. — Attempt to see the reported traffic.
— Notify ATC.
